Understanding Medicare Supplement Plans in Arizona

If you’re a Medicare beneficiary in Arizona, you may find that your healthcare needs are not fully covered by Original Medicare. Medicare supplement insurance, also known as Medigap, can help fill the gaps in coverage and reduce your out-of-pocket expenses.

Medicare supplement plans in Arizona are offered by private insurance companies, but they are standardized by the federal government. This ensures that the basic benefits of each plan are the same, regardless of which insurance company you choose.

There are ten standard Medicare supplement plans available in Arizona, each labeled with a letter A through N. The benefits of each plan vary, but all plans cover some or all of the costs of Medicare Part A and B coinsurance, copayments, and deductibles.

Exploring Medicare Advantage Plans in Arizona

When it comes to exploring your healthcare options as a Medicare beneficiary in Arizona, Medicare Advantage plans offer a unique alternative to traditional Medicare supplement plans. Medicare Advantage plans, also known as Medicare Part C, are offered by private insurance companies and provide all the benefits of Original Medicare, including hospital and medical coverage.

However, these plans offer additional benefits that are not covered under Original Medicare, including prescription drug coverage, vision, hearing, and dental coverage.

Arizona Medicare Advantage plans have become increasingly popular in recent years, with over 560,000 beneficiaries enrolled in these plans as of 2021. These plans offer flexibility and may be a good option for those who want comprehensive coverage without paying the high premiums of some Medicare supplement plans.

It’s important to note that Medicare Advantage plans typically have provider networks, which means you may need to use healthcare providers within the plan’s network to receive coverage. Additionally, some plans may require prior authorization for certain procedures or services.

Understanding Medicare Part D Plans in Arizona

If you are a Medicare beneficiary in Arizona, you may have discovered that Original Medicare does not cover most prescription drugs. This gap in coverage can leave you with hefty out-of-pocket expenses for vital medications. That’s where Medicare Part D plans come in.

Medicare Part D plans are standalone prescription drug plans offered by private insurance companies. These plans work alongside Original Medicare or Medicare supplement plans to help cover the costs of your prescription drugs.

It’s important to note that Medicare Part D plans vary in terms of their formularies, which is a list of drugs that the plan covers. Premiums, deductibles, co-payments, and coinsurance can also differ between plans. Therefore, it’s essential to compare different plans to find one that suits your budget and medication needs.

How to Enroll in a Medicare Part D Plan in Arizona

You can sign up for a Medicare Part D plan during the annual enrollment period, which typically runs from October 15 to December 7 each year. You can also enroll in a plan when you become eligible for Medicare or during a special enrollment period if you experience certain life events.

Key Considerations when Choosing a Medicare Part D Plan in Arizona

When comparing different Medicare Part D plans in Arizona, keep the following factors in mind:

  • The formulary: Make sure the drugs you need are covered by the plan.
  • The costs: Consider the monthly premium, deductible, copayments, and coinsurance.
  • The pharmacy network: Check if your preferred pharmacy is in the plan’s network.
  • The ratings and reviews: Look for plans with high ratings and positive reviews from current members.

By carefully considering these factors, you can find a Medicare Part D plan in Arizona that provides the right coverage and fits your budget.

What are Medicare supplement plans?

Medicare supplement plans, also known as Medigap plans, are private health insurance policies that can be purchased to supplement Original Medicare coverage. These plans help cover costs such as de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ance that are not covered by Medicare alone.

How do Medicare supplement plans work in Arizona?

Medicare supplement plans work in Arizona by providing additional coverage to fill the gaps in Original Medicare. These plans are standardized by the government, meaning that the benefits of each plan are the same regardless of the insurance company you choose. It is important to compare plans and prices to find the best option for your needs.

What are the benefits of Medicare supplement plans in Arizona?

Medicare supplement plans in Arizona offer various benefits, including additional coverage for hospital stays, skilled nursing facility care, and Medicare Part B excess charges. They also allow you to choose any doctor or specialist who accepts Medicare patients without the need for referrals or network restrictions.

What are Medicare Advantage plans and how do they differ from Medicare supplement plans?

Medicare Advantage plans are an alternative to Original Medicare and Medicare supplement plans. These plans bundle Medicare Parts A, B, and often Part D (prescription drug coverage) into one plan offered by private insurance companies. Unlike Medicare supplement plans, Medicare Advantage plans typically have network restrictions and may require referrals for specialist visits.

What are Medicare Part D plans and how do they work in Arizona?

Medicare Part D plans are prescription drug plans that can be added to Original Medicare or a Medicare supplement plan to provide coverage for prescription medications. In Arizona, these plans are offered by private insurance companies and can help reduce out-of-pocket costs for prescription drugs.
